Srinagar–Jammu Highway reopens; flight, rail services return to normal

Air and rail services also witnessed significant improvement, providing much-needed relief to commuters, tourists, and local residents.
Rail services also played a crucial role in easing travel disruptions caused by adverse weather.
The Jammu Division of Northern Railway operated special reserved trains between Katra and Srinagar, adding two additional AC coaches on Wednesday to accommodate 144 extra passengers.
Over 1,650 passengers travelled on these special trains, achieving full occupancy and generating record revenue.
“More than 3,000 passengers travelled on these special trains over the two days and expressed their gratitude to the railways.
